The first minor-league game I ever covered was the Charleston (SC) Rainbows (a San Diego Padres affiliate), and then Charleston got the RiverDogs, an affiliate of the Tampa Bay Rays.

When we moved to North Carolina, I covered the Winston-Salem Warthogs, and the Warthogs were replaced by the Winston-Salem Dash (both White Sox affiliates).

I don't remember their opponents that well, but I do remember the Kannapolis (NC) Intimidators, named after the late Dale Earnhardt's nickname. That team is now the Cannon Ballers, I learned recently.

I won't try to list ALL of the minor-league teams here, but I'll add a few with interesting names or notable backgrounds. On the TV show M*A*S*H, Max Klinger often talked about the Toledo Mud Hens and wore a Mud Hens baseball cap. You'll find them below.
